If you or your loved one has been diagnosed with a terminal illness and you have decided to spend as much time as possible at home with your soulmate, whether as caregiver or patient, you are not alone. You are starting down a road that neither of you have traveled before, and one that will end in death and separation. It is not an easy road and there will be many potholes in the way, but it must be traveled. There are many alternative pathways, but they all converge at the end of the journey. There is no turning back, no matter how much you wish for a different ending. When my wife Gerda was given the diagnosis of incurable cancer, we chose to stay at home and be together until the end. This book explains what we did, what we thought and how we reacted to each new circumstance that arose. The story takes you from diagnosis to death, and then through the first seven months of grief and recovery. Hang on tight because the road is bumpy and the direction is not always clear.
